Given : ` 2 N_(2) O (g) hArr 2 N_(2) (g) + O_(2) (g) , K= 3*5 xx 10^(33)` ` 2 NO _(2) (g) hArr N_(2) (g) + 2 O_(2) (g) , K= 6*7 xx 10^(16)` ` 2 NO (g) hArr N_(2) (g) + O_(2) (g) , K= 2*2 xx 10^(30)` ` 2 N_(2)O_(5) (g) hArr 2 N_(2) (g) + 5 O_(2) (g), K+1*2 xx 10^(34)` Which oxide of nitrogen is most stable ?A. `N_(2)O`B. `NO_(2)`C. NOD. `N_(2) O_(5)` |
|
Answer» Correct Answer - B Lower the value of K, less is the dissociation and hence grater is the stability. |
